A man who trafficked fentanyl and cocaine and illegally possessed 17 firearms inside his Wicker Park home has been sentenced to nine years in federal prison, officials announced Thursday.
Hugo Pinzon, 36, pleaded guilty to federal drug and firearm charges in exchange for the sentence from U.S. District Judge John Kness, according to the U.S. Attorney’s Office in Chicago.
A confidential informant told Homeland Security Investigations agents in January 2024 that a man known as “Hugo” or “Juiceman” was selling cocaine in the Chicagoland area, sparking the probe. Agents arranged for the informant to make several controlled buys worth thousands of dollars from Pinzon before the informant died in a car crash on March 5, 2024, court records show…
